A lean 6'4" athlete, Thompson is the kind of player that Miami is looking to make the standard at the skill positions. He has size, speed, and great skill. This is definitely a good addition to the 2018 class.
Thompson, who claims offers from Louisville and Southern Miss in addition to his Miami offer, is the 6th commit in the 2018 class. He joins Daquris Wiggins at WR in his class, and DBs Josh Jobe, Gilbert Frierson, Thomas Burns, and Jalen Patterson in the class as a whole.
